Justice ministry: WB elections null and void

[ 10/02/2011 – 10:09 AM ]

 

GAZA, (PIC)– The justice ministry in Gaza has lashed out at the illegitimate Ramallah government of Salam Fayyad for calling for local elections next July, describing the process as null and void.

The ministry in a statement on Wednesday evening said that the Fayyad government is illegitimate and thus has no right to call for elections.

The call for elections would deepen internal Palestinian division and would bring about illegitimate local councils, it elaborated.

The ministry urged all Palestinian factions to reject the call because it contravened the constitution and law.

For its part, the Ahrar faction described the call for elections as “frivolous”, adding in a statement on Wednesday that the step was an attempt to circumvent the Palestinian de facto situation.

Holding such elections without national consensus was “invalid”, Ahrar said, affirming it would not recognize such elections or their results.
